Announcement of UK SPEAR WORKSHOP - University of Leicester - 8 April 2002

In view of the forthcoming operational phase of the SPEAR system (expected test operations April 2003), we propose to hold a short one-day workshop for the benefit of potential users in the UK community. The workshop will include:

  1. A restatement of science goals with short presentations by Terry Robinson (Overview and status), Ian McCrea(Joint ESR/SPEAR operations), Farideh Honary (High power experiments), Tim Yeoman (Artificial irregularity/CUTLASS experiments), Darren Wright(Coordinated ground/Satellite experiments in particular future SPEAR/CLUSTER links), Mark Lester (All-sky low power radar experiments).

  2. Update on technical specification and progress on construction and deployment (Chris Thomas).

  3. Data visualization-a first look(Nigel Wade)

  4. Open discussion - The idea here is to get feedback from the UK community on (i) what experiments future users might want to do with the system and (ii) on data visualization needs.
